This wine just sings! Dark fruit of plum and cherry jump out of the glass with some clove. On the palate, the wine is fresh, with violets red grapefruit and dark plums on the finish. But the rounded tannins provide a touch of class, whereas I am just rounded, without the class.

Lua Cheia
Lua Cheia-Saven may have started in reverse, but it’s now one of Portugal’s fastest-rising names. With vineyards across Douro, Vinho Verde, Dão and Alentejo, and winemaker Francisco Baptista at the helm, they’ve built a reputation for smart, great-value wines that overdeliver. Throw in the odd ocean-aged experiment and you’ve got a producer that’s credible, creative and right up our street.
